33Independent Office for Police ConductU.K.

This section has no associated Explanatory Notes

(1)The body corporate known as the Independent Police Complaints Commission—

(a)is to continue to exist, and

(b)is to be known instead as the Independent Office for Police Conduct.

(2)Section 9 of the Police Reform Act 2002 (which established the Independent Police Complaints Commission) is amended in accordance with subsections (3) to (8).

(3)For the heading substitute “ The Independent Office for Police Conduct ”.

(4)For subsection (1) substitute—

(1)The body corporate previously known as the Independent Police Complaints Commission—

(a)is to continue to exist, and

(b)is to be known instead as the Independent Office for Police Conduct.

(5)For subsection (2) substitute—

(2)The Office is to consist of—

(a)a Director General appointed by Her Majesty, and

(b)at least six other members.

(2A)The other members must consist of—

(a)persons appointed as non-executive members (see paragraph 1A of Schedule 2), and

(b)persons appointed as employee members (see paragraph 1B of that Schedule),

but the powers of appointment under those paragraphs must be exercised so as to secure that a majority of members of the Office (including the Director General) are non-executive members.

(6)In subsection (3)—

(a)for “chairman of the Commission” substitute “ Director General ”;

(b)omit “, or as another member of the Commission,”.

(7)In subsection (5)—

(a)for “The Commission shall not—” substitute “ Neither the Office nor the Director General shall— ”;

(b)for “Commission's” substitute “Office's”.

(8)In subsection (6) for “Commission” substitute “ Office ”.

(9)Schedule 9 makes further provision in relation to the Independent Office for Police Conduct.

Commencement Information

I1S. 33 in force for specified purposes at Royal Assent, see s. 183

I2S. 33(9) in force at 17.7.2017 for specified purposes by S.I. 2017/726, reg. 2(d)

I3S. 33 in force at 8.1.2018 in so far as not already in force by S.I. 2017/1249, reg. 2 (with reg. 3)
